Dream Team : Jeff Dooley

I have followed Sheffield Tigers for well over 30 years. As a lad we used to go from Sheffield to Halifax on the public serice bus for about 25 pence. We now run the Hanley Collectables website, full of speedway memorabillia. The team I have picked is full of entertainers.

Shawn MoranChris Morton

Shawn Moran
Just a great team man and all round good guy. I remember the times he spent crossed legged in the bar talking to the kids.

Kelly Moran
Could have been the best in the world. What a pair Shawn and Kelly made together. A true champion but just enjoyed life too much.

Peter Collins
1976 World Champion. Deserved more, if only he could gate. But boy could he team ride with Morton.

Chris Morton
One of the best team riders ever seen. Always a pleasure to talk with. (read his book please).

Roman Matousek
Well they called him the showman at Sheffield and he did just that. You just never knew what you would get from him next.

Sean Wilson
Guess you couldn't pair him with Roman, but one of the most popular modern Sheffield riders. Just seemed to be able to pull that extra yard when needed.

Kyle Legault
Kyle would kill me if I didn't pick him. (Well we do sponsor him) Neil Machin tells me he is the most popular rider at Sheffield today. I feel he is very much out of the Shawn Moran mould with the kids. Also has a never say die attude to his racing. But still a long way to go. Just happy to be involved with a rider with so much talent.
